(1) All streets within right-of-way that are dedicated on a plat, or within existing right-of-way that is not serviced and maintained by the city, shall be constructed by the subdivider for the full width, from back-of-sidewalk to back-of-sidewalk, to current community street and utility standards. Where the plat is adjacent to streets that are serviced and maintained by the city, the subdivider will only be required to improve the portion of the street that is the responsibility of the plat to current community street and utility standards.

(2) The city may negotiate with the subdivider to install street improvements beyond the subdivision, which will connect existing improved streets to the subdivision; or to improve existing streets within or adjacent to the subdivision that are maintained and serviced by the city. All negotiated reimbursements for additional street improvements will be paid to the subdivider after the project is complete and accepted by city council. No approval for reimbursement is authorized by the city unless a written approval by the city for said reimbursement is sent to the subdivider prior to construction. (Ord. 411 § 1, 2008)
